The Hidden Dangers of Voltage Imbalance
When voltage measurements between solar panels and earth stray beyond normal ranges (typically 0-30V DC), it signals potential threats like:
- Insulation degradation in cables
- Moisture ingress in connectors
- Grounding system failures
Take California's 2022 wildfire case: Faulty grounding in a 5MW solar farm caused persistent voltage leakage, ultimately damaging inverters worth $200,000. This real-world example shows why proactive voltage monitoring matters.
Root Causes Explained
1. Grounding System Failures
Over 60% of voltage irregularities trace back to compromised grounding. Key factors include:
- Corroded grounding rods
- Loose terminal connections
- Soil resistivity changes after heavy rains
Pro Tip: Test ground resistance quarterly – values above 25Ω require immediate attention per NEC 690.47 standards.

Practical Solutions from Industry Experts
EK SOLAR's engineering team recommends this three-step approach:
- Diagnostic Testing
- Insulation resistance checks (min. 1MΩ)
- Ground potential rise measurements
- Preventive Maintenance
- Annual thermographic inspections
- Bi-annual grounding system verification
- Advanced Protection
- GFDI (Ground Fault Detection Interruption) devices
- Surge protection modules

FAQ Section
- Q: How often should I test panel-to-ground voltage? A: Quarterly for commercial systems, bi-annually for residential setups.
- Q: Can voltage issues void panel warranties? A: Yes, if caused by improper installation – always use certified technicians.
